Waste management is a collective activity involving segregation, collection, transportation, re-processing, recycling and disposal of various types of wastes.






NO TIME TO WASTE

Waste segregation has always been blantly ignored around the world. However, COVID-19 pandemic saw a sudden surge in the amount of waste generated globally. Now with the additional awareness of infectious waste, proper segregation has become the need of the hour.
Despite government campaigns, its implementation has been a challenge due to people’s ignorance and apathy. Also, inadequate knowledge and improper handling is leading to serious risks.

OBJECTIVE
The purpose is to design a visual identity that motivates evveryone to segerate waste.
The main purpose is to redesign waste management icons making it less daunting for laymen & simplifying the information.
Standardize color codes & symbols for people to register easily and prompt user to always segregate the waste be it residential or non -residential places.
CHALLENGES
The current waste segregation system is limited to only dry and wet waste.
Failing to segregate waste properly means that it will end up mixed in landfills the same way it was mixed in your bins releasing harmful gases.
SOlUTION
With the major concern of waste segregation into consideration we have come up with simple visual design solution.
Using Standardized color codes and symbols
Annotation of the symbols on the product/packaging
Easy to spot at night.

USAGE
Variations
The logos will only be used in the following 4 variations when placed on a campaign related material.
When used on the packaging of a product, the logos can be used in white or black as well and the minimum size should be 1 cm.
%20(1).png)



Location
Our project is aimed at targeting public places like – schools, malls, airports, roads, outside residential areas, etc.
In locations with a space crunch 3 bins will be kept – Biodegradable, Non-biodegradable and COVID-19 waste.
In locations that do not have a space limitation, more bins can be placed.
